Asphalt Shingles



When picking roof covering materials, take into consideration the sturdiness and cost-effectiveness of asphalt shingles. Asphalt shingles are a prominent selection for property roofing systems due to their cost and ease of setup. These shingles are readily available in various styles and shades, enabling you to personalize the appearance of your home. In addition, asphalt shingles are fairly reduced upkeep, needing periodic maintenances.

One essential advantage of asphalt shingles is their toughness. While they may not last as long as some other roof products, such as steel roofing systems, asphalt tiles can still provide a trustworthy covering for your home for 15 to thirty years, relying on the top quality of the tiles and the environment in which you live.


An additional benefit of asphalt shingles is their cost-effectiveness. Contrasted to products like floor tile roof covering, asphalt tiles are more economical, making them a practical choice for many property owners.

Metal Roofs



Steel roofings provide a streamlined and contemporary option to conventional roof covering products. They're known for their resilience and longevity, frequently lasting half a century or more with appropriate maintenance.

Among https://www.solarpowerworldonline.com/2021/04/gaf-energy-expands-services-to-allow-roofing-partners-to-become-full-fledged-solar-installation-companies/ of steel roofings is their resistance to severe climate condition, consisting of heavy rain, snow, and high winds. This makes them an excellent selection for house owners in areas susceptible to severe weather condition.

Along with their strength, metal roofing systems are energy effective, mirroring the sunlight's rays to help maintain your home colder in the summer months. This can bring about reduced power expenses and reduced carbon exhausts.

Metal roofing systems are also light-weight, putting less anxiety on the structure of your home contrasted to larger roofing products.

While metal roofing systems have several advantages, they can be a lot more costly ahead of time than other roof options. Ceramic tile Roof covering



Roofing materials play a significant role in the general aesthetics and capability of your home. When it pertains to ceramic tile roofing, you're looking at a durable and long-lasting option that adds a touch of beauty to your residential or commercial property. Floor tile roof coverings are understood for their outstanding resistance to fire, rot, and bug damage, making them a trustworthy option for home owners looking for longevity.

One of the disadvantages of ceramic tile roofing is its weight, which may call for added structural support. This can boost the first installment prices. While ceramic tile roofs are durable, private ceramic tiles can crack under extreme problems, bring about prospective upkeep problems.

However, with appropriate installation and maintenance, tile roof covering can last for decades, giving a beautiful and useful covering for your home.
